We actually met some people doing something like this in Cambridge when MagicSolver was just starting - a group called imense (http://www.imense.com/). They have an automated picture tagger. You give it a picture of a field of sunflowers, for example, and it comes up with 'flowers, nature, field, ...'. I imagine that if you made it domain-specific (your PCB example), you might be able to actually classify the objects.
